Online tickets are $3 to $5 less than at Gate!
Normal gate tickets are $15 for adults, $10 for ages 12-17, and FREE for 11 and under.
Online tickets prices take $3 off the first day, and $5 off the second day.
For example, an online single day ticket is $12, or a two day ticket is $22.
At Gate, receive $5 off tickets for people in FULL costume!
Normal gate tickets are $15 for adults, $10 for ages 12-17, and FREE for 11 and under.
If you are in FULL costume, we will take $5 off your ticket price.
For example, an adult in normal clothing is $15, but their 10 year old kid in full costume is only $5.
If you don't dress up, buy online! If you DO dress up, buy in person!

On Saturday, watch professional Highland Games athlete compete in 8 different games, all of which involve throwing heavy things really far!
On Sunday, instead of watching Highland Games, you can try YOUR hand at them! Two professionals will guide the strong and brave through the Caber Toss and Weight Over Bar. Test your mettle and become the Highland Games!
